
Application Modernization: Competitive Advantage Delivered
Facing mounting pressure to adapt and grow, businesses across industries are discovering that non-standardized, outdated applications can stifle innovation and increase costs. Our modernization services replace legacy bottlenecks with scalable, cloud-native solutions that reduce time-to-market, simplify compliance, ensure business continuity, and boost resilience. By placing our deep domain expertise, proven frameworks, and strategic alignment workshops at your disposal, we integrate new technologies with minimal disruption, helping your business seize emerging opportunities.
Solutions
Application Assessment
Combine a thorough understanding of an application’s architecture, codebase, security needs, and dependencies with business plans to get recommendations for improvement.
Business Process Mining
Deconstruct applications and discover process flows and inefficiencies by thoroughly extracting business requirements from software to identify areas for improvement.
Migration Services
Shift workloads to AWS, Azure, or GCP and capitalize on standards-based, cloud-native infrastructure to lower costs and enhance resilience, scalability, and agility.
Remediation Services
Enhance application functionality and performance by refactoring code, implementing security enhancements, and ensuring compatibility with cloud services and environments.
Rebuild Services
Reconstruct applications from scratch while maintaining their scope and utilizing cloud-native services like auto-scaling and modern practices such as CI/CD.
Testing & Quality Assurance
Ensure modernized applications work as intended. Services include functional, performance, and security testing, as well as API integration and data warehouse testing.
Application Maintenance, Support, & Enhancement
Access multiple levels of support, including incident management and reporting. Further enhance application performance and expand functionality to meet evolving business needs.
SaaS Development
Transform applications into secure, scalable, multi-tenant cloud services. Accelerate deployment with Microservices Accelerator Framework and reusable components.
Capabilities

Architectural & Code Analysis
We conduct comprehensive reviews of your application’s architecture and codebase to identify bottlenecks, technical debt, and opportunities for modernization, guiding refactoring, re-platforming, and rebuilding.

Security & Compliance Auditing
We assess your application's security posture and regulatory compliance, identifying vulnerabilities and ensuring continuous risk mitigation throughout and after modernization.

Business Alignment Workshops
We work with stakeholders to align modernization goals with business needs, identifying dependencies that enable us to achieve meaningful business outcomes.

Cloud & DevOps Expertise
We leverage leading cloud platforms (AWS, Azure, GCP) and DevOps tools to modernize applications for scalability, performance, and automation through containerization, infrastructure as code (IaC), and cloud-native architectures.

CI/CD & Automation Integration
We set up CI/CD pipelines to accelerate release cycles, enhance quality, and minimize manual effort.

Process Optimization using Mining Tools
We analyze workflow data leveraging process mining tools to pinpoint inefficiencies and identify opportunities for automation or redesign, thereby enhancing operational efficiency and system responsiveness.

Custom API & Microservices Development
We architect and build custom APIs and microservices to decouple legacy monoliths, enabling easier maintenance, improved scalability, and seamless integration with modern platforms.
Methodology
Our proven methodology enables enterprises to modernize their applications strategically, striking a balance between business value, risk, and agility. It consists of four key phases:
Assess
We initiate modernization with a structured, tool-driven assessment of architecture, infrastructure, and business alignment, combining stakeholder interviews with leading frameworks, such as the 5A Assessment Model and the Well-Architected Review Framework.
- Key Focus Areas: Business fit, business value, agility and cost, complexity, and risk
- 5A Assessment Model: Assimilate, assess, and analyze your infrastructure, applications, and workflows to identify gaps and opportunities. Advocate and amend strategies, incorporating feedback to define and refine a targeted, business-aligned modernization roadmap.
Plan and Prepare
Leveraging assessment insights, we craft a tailored cloud-native modernization roadmap that focuses on design, technology selection, cloud-native readiness, and a smooth migration with minimal operational disruption.
- Planning Deliverables: Modern architecture blueprint, technology and platform selection, migration and transformation roadmap, resource and risk planning.
- Frameworks Used: Cloud Adoption Framework (AWS, Azure, GCP), Agile/Scrum Delivery Models, Risk and Change Management
Modernize
Guided by our 7R Framework, we modernize apps, whether it's lift-and-shift, re-platforming, or re-architecting, tightly aligned with your business goals. The 7Rs cover:
- Rehost: Lift and shift, adopted in large legacy migration scenarios.
- Retain: Adopted for apps that are good for use as-is.
- Re-platform: Lift and reshape to achieve tangible business benefits.
- Replace: Drop and Shop, Repurchase/Replace to move to a different product to reap cloud benefits.
- Refactor: Driven by a strong business need to add features, scale, or performance.
- Re-architect: Driven by a requirement for cloud-native features to achieve market fit.
- Reimagine/Retire: Transforming or decommissioning applications based on business value.

Manage and Optimize
Ongoing management, performance monitoring, and continuous optimization are provided after modernization to ensure stability, cost efficiency, and business continuity. The methodology covers operational excellence (CloudOps and support services, CI/CD pipeline maintenance, application performance monitoring (APM), continuous improvement and retrospectives, productivity enhancements for dev teams, and TCO reduction and operational risk mitigation) and frameworks/approaches (Site Reliability Engineering (SRE), cloud operations framework, DevOps maturity models).
Our Strategic Differentiators
Proven Modernization Experience
Trusted across global core banking transformations
Accelerators & Reusable IPs
Ready-made tools and templates to reduce effort
Cloud & Hybrid Architecture Expertise
Deep Azure, Kubernetes, and microservices know-how
Full-Stack Tooling Integration
CAST, SonarQube, FinOps for insight and control
Low-Risk, Phased Delivery
Co-existence and observability-first strategy
Commercial Flexibility & Value
Outcome-based pricing and lean team structures
Our Partners
FAQs
1. Why is application modernization critical for today’s businesses?
Modernization replaces outdated systems, ensuring agility, lower costs, and enabling integration of cloud-native technologies for greater innovation.
2. What types of modernization approaches do you offer?
We offer a range of options, from lift-and-shift to re-architecting and SaaS transformation, guided by frameworks and models such as the 7R model, ensuring alignment with business priorities and a gradual migration with minimal disruption.
3. How do you ensure security and compliance during and after modernization?
Security audits and continuous monitoring are integrated into our workflows; we also adhere to leading compliance standards to mitigate risks and safeguard data throughout the modernization process.